Voltar ao blog
Tor Post #1

Como se tornar um Relay Tor

Por Leonam 25 de mar. 2026 3 min de leitura

Como se tornar um Relay Tor

Opa, aqui quem fala é o Leonam e no vídeo de hoje vou te ensinar como se tornar um Relay Tor. Também vou explicar como escolher qual tipo de relay você quer ser.

Caso você queira saber mais sobre o Tor e uma forma lúdica de como ele funciona, vou deixar no card e no primeiro comentário fixado um vídeo sobre o Tor.

Agradecimento: Quero agradecer ao Guilherme Diniz, esse vídeo só foi possível graças a ele. Obrigado Diniz, tamo junto.

Capa do Tor

🛠️ Preparando o ambiente

Primeiro de tudo, você deve ter um lugar para rodar o serviço do Tor, seja um Raspberry Pi, uma VPS, uma máquina virtual, etc. No meu caso, vou utilizar a VPS que o Guilherme patrocinou para nós.

⚠️ Disclaimer

Não estou preocupado em vazar o IP e nem nada pelos seguintes motivos:

  • Motivo 1: Essa máquina será destruída assim que eu terminar o vídeo.
  • Motivo 2: Como o relay é público, ele pode ser localizado facilmente no Tor Metrics.

Dito isso, agora vou logar no servidor para podermos criar um relay para transmitir o tráfego da rede Tor.


🔄 Atualizando o servidor

sudo apt update && sudo apt upgrade -y

Se você estiver em uma VPS, é interessante instalar algum firewall, mesmo que básico como o UFW. Agora vamos instalar tudo o que será necessário:

sudo apt install tor nyx micro ufw -y

O que cada pacote faz:

  • Tor: Serviço essencial do relay.
  • Nyx: Monitor de terminal para obter informações sobre o serviço Tor.
  • Micro: Editor de texto (similar ao Nano, mas mais amigável).
  • UFW: Firewall simplificado.

🛡️ Configurando o firewall

Primeiro vamos liberar a porta do SSH (para não perder a conexão):

sudo ufw allow 22

Agora, você precisa liberar a porta que vai rodar o Tor. A porta 9001 é a padrão, mas costuma ser bloqueada em alguns países. A porta 443 (HTTPS) é recomendada, pois dificilmente é bloqueada. No meu caso, vou utilizar a 443:

sudo ufw allow 443
sudo ufw enable

Verifique o status:

sudo ufw status verbose

⚙️ Configurando o Tor

Os arquivos de configuração ficam em /etc/tor. O arquivo que nos interessa é o torrc. Edite-o com o micro:

sudo micro /etc/tor/torrc

Principais configurações:

  1. Nickname: Defina o nome do seu relay.
Nickname MeuRelay
  1. E-mail (opcional): Recomendado se você for um Exit Node.
ContactInfo [email protected]
  1. Porta: Mesma porta que você liberou no UFW.
ORPort 443
  1. Tipo de relay: * Middle Relay: Mais seguro legalmente (não sabe a origem nem o destino).
  • Exit Node: Não recomendado para iniciantes devido a implicações legais.

Para ser apenas um middle relay, configure:

ExitRelay 0
Importante: Nunca configure um Exit Node na sua internet residencial. Você pode ter problemas legais, ver muitos captchas e até perder seu contrato com a operadora.

Limitando banda (opcional)

RelayBandwidthRate 100 KB
RelayBandwidthBurst 200 KB

Reiniciando o serviço

sudo systemctl restart tor

📊 Configurando o Nyx

Por padrão, o Nyx precisa de privilégios de superusuário. Para rodar sem sudo:

sudo usermod -aG debian-tor $USER

Após o comando, reinicie sua sessão SSH. Agora basta digitar:

nyx

📌 Considerações finais

  • Seu relay não aparecerá imediatamente no Tor Metrics. Pode levar de 2 a 24 horas.
  • Nos 3 primeiros dias ele será pouco utilizado. Com o tempo, o consumo de banda aumenta.

Então é isso, meus camaradinhas. Qualquer dúvida, deixem nos comentários que eu ajudo vocês!